Today on The Richard Syrett Show: Peter LaBarbera, author for WND brings up the massive meta-study on mask-wearing being the end to the COVID narrative. Journalist for True North, Sue-Ann Levy discusses Canada’s largest school board making a course on Indigenous texts. Then a founding member of caWsbar, Heather Mason talks about a study that found nearly 46% of trans-women inmates were convicted of sex crimes.
Tom Korski, managing editor at Blacklocks reacts to Attorney General David Lametti losing a critical federal court ruling for his use of powers against the Freedom Convoy. Journalist for True North, Elie Cantin-Nantel, looks at SFU’s “climate change anxiety” seminars. Ontario director for the Canadian Taxpayers Federation Jay Goldberg, on the Senator saying the heritage minister shouldn’t define Canadian Content. Reporter for the Western Standard Christopher Oldcorn, shares the protests in Saskatoon over a naked man in the little girls’ change room at the pool.
